“They Came For Me, They Can Come For You” – Former Trump Adviser Peter Navarro Reports To Prison

Peter Navarro voiced frustration at a press conference on March 19, just before turning himself over to authorities in Miami, Florida, to begin his four-month sentence at the city’s minimum-security prison.

Mr. Navarro declined to turn over records for the committee, citing the former president’s executive privilege that allows some presidential records to be blocked from disclosure.

“I am not nervous,” Mr. Navarro said to a reporter on March 19. “I am pissed.”

“When I walk in that prison today, the justice system, such as it is, will have done a crippling blow to the constitutional separation of powers of executive privilege,” he added.

Mr. Navarro reaffirmed his belief that a White House aide cannot be compelled by Congress to testify, and repeated his claims of executive privilege regarding the documents and testimony that the House Jan. 6 select committee was seeking through its subpoena.
